suppose that you are headed toward a plateau 34.8 meters high. if the angle of elevation to the top of the plateau is 26.5°, how far are you from the base of the plateau? what is your distance from the base of the plateau? □ meters (round to one decimal place as needed.)

Explanation:

Step1: Identify the trigonometric relationship

We have a right triangle where the height of the plateau (opposite side to the angle of elevation) is \( 34.8 \) meters, the angle of elevation \( \theta = 26.5^\circ \), and we need to find the adjacent side (distance from the base, let's call it \( x \)). The tangent function relates the opposite and adjacent sides: \( \tan\theta=\frac{\text{opposite}}{\text{adjacent}} \), so \( \tan(26.5^\circ)=\frac{34.8}{x} \).

Step2: Solve for \( x \)

Rearrange the formula to solve for \( x \): \( x = \frac{34.8}{\tan(26.5^\circ)} \). Calculate \( \tan(26.5^\circ) \approx 0.5005 \). Then \( x=\frac{34.8}{0.5005}\approx 69.5 \).

Answer:

\( 69.5 \)
